Abstract
A toner mass developed control system for use with electronic printers or copiers provides for the measurement of toned photoconductor reflectivity and bare photoconductor reflectivity. The standard control ratio is modified by characterizing the particular sensor unit in use and by taking into account the reflectance from both photoconductor and toner in the toned patch reflectivity measurement. These factors together with a modification for photoconductor reflectance degradation enable accurate control in high optical density development and with highly reflective color toners by altering the control ratio in accordance with these factors.
